Enhancing Academic Performance Through Technology Through Personalized Learning
Every student learns differently. Traditional teaching methods often struggle to accommodate varying learning styles, abilities, and learning speeds.
Modern educational technology allows instructors to personalize learning by providing customized lessons and adaptive content based on individual student progress.
Adaptive Learning Platforms
Adaptive learning systems analyze student performance and adjust learning materials accordingly. Students receive additional support in areas where they need improvement while progressing more quickly through topics they already understand.
This personalized approach helps improve comprehension, confidence, and overall academic achievement.
Self-Paced Learning
Digital learning platforms allow students to study at their own pace. They can revisit lessons, review recorded lectures, and complete exercises whenever needed.
Self-paced learning reduces pressure and gives students greater control over their educational journey.

Challenges of Technology Integration in Education
Although technology offers many advantages, successful implementation requires careful planning.
Educational institutions may encounter challenges including:
- Unequal access to digital devices
- Limited internet connectivity
- Data privacy concerns
- Teacher training requirements
- Technology maintenance costs
- Digital distractions
Addressing these challenges through investment, policy development, and professional training ensures that technology supports meaningful learning outcomes.
